Ignaux
Ignaux is a commune in the Ariège department in southwestern France. Ignaux has an elevation of 1,009 metres.Photo: Jack ma, CC BY-SA 3.0.

Ax-les-Thermes station is a railway station in Ax-les-Thermes, Occitanie, France. The station is on the Portet-Saint-Simon–Puigcerdà railway. The station is served by TER and Intercités de Nuit services operated by the SNCF.
